STANDARD COMPACTION TEST AZA0864
The AZA0864 Standard Compaction Test Apparatus from Azalab is precision-engineered to perform the British Standard Proctor (Light Compaction) Test, as specified in BS 1377-4 and BS 1924-2. This apparatus is used to determine the Maximum Dry Density (MDD) and Optimum Moisture Content (OMC) of soils subjected to light compactive effort.
The test simulates field compaction achieved by light rollers and rammers and is essential for quality control of subgrades, embankments, road bases, and foundation soils. Purpose & Significance
The Standard Compaction Test establishes the relationship between moisture content and dry density of soil under controlled compaction energy. Determination of MDD and OMC allows engineers to:
-
Specify target field compaction levels
-
Ensure soil stability and load-bearing capacity
-
Control moisture during construction
-
Prevent settlement and shear failure

Test Procedure (BS Method)
-
Soil is compacted in 3 equal layers
-
Each layer receives 27 blows using the 2.5 kg rammer
-
Excess soil is trimmed and mould is weighed
-
Moisture content is determined by oven drying
-
Dry density vs moisture content curve is plotted
-
OMC and MDD are obtained from the curve

Frequently Asked Questions (FAQ)
Q1: How does this differ from ASTM D698 apparatus?
BS standards use a 105 mm mould and 2.5 kg rammer, whereas ASTM uses a 100 mm mould and slightly different energy parameters.
Q2: What soil types is AZA0864 suitable for?
Best suited for fine-grained and medium plastic soils. Coarse soils require heavy compaction testing.
Q3: Is a gunmetal mould available?
Yes. Gunmetal moulds can be supplied on request for enhanced corrosion resistance.
Q4: Can this be used on site?
Yes. With an optional carrying case, it is suitable for both laboratory and field use.
Q5: Is this equivalent to the Standard Proctor Test?
Yes. It represents the British Standard equivalent of the light compaction (Standard Proctor) method.

Principle of Operation
A soil paste prepared at a known moisture content is placed in the sample cup. The stainless steel cone, of specified mass and angle, is allowed to penetrate the soil freely for 5 seconds. The depth of penetration (up to 20 mm) is measured using a precision depth gauge. The moisture content corresponding to 20 mm penetration is defined as the liquid limit of the soil.Standards Compliance
